CVE-2018-3050 is a high-severity vulnerability affecting Oracle Banking Corporate Lending versions 12.3.0, 12.4.0, 12.5.0, 14.0.0, and 14.1.0. This easily exploitable flaw allows a low-privileged attacker with network access via HTTP to compromise the system. Successful exploitation can lead to unauthorized creation, deletion, or modification of critical data, as well as complete access to all accessible data within the application. The CVSS 3.0 Base Score is 8.1, indicating high impacts on confidentiality and integrity. There is currently no evidence of active exploitation, public exploit code, or significant community discussion surrounding this vulnerability.
